MIR4475
Summary
MIR4475 is a non-coding RNA[1].
Key Facts
- MIR4475's instance of is recorded as non-coding RNA[2].
- MIR4475's instance of is recorded as gene[3].
- MIR4475 is a type of non-coding RNA[4].
- MIR4475's genomic start is recorded as 36823539[5].
- MIR4475's genomic start is recorded as 36823536[6].
- MIR4475's genomic end is recorded as 36823599[7].
- MIR4475's genomic end is recorded as 36823596[8].
- MIR4475's found in taxon is recorded as Homo sapiens[9].
- MIR4475's chromosome is recorded as human chromosome 9[10].
- MIR4475's strand orientation is recorded as reverse strand[11].
- MIR4475's exact match is recorded as http://identifiers.org/ncbigene/100616289[12].
- MIR4475's cytogenetic location is recorded as 9p13.2[13].
